Abstract
The objective of this study is to develop an error estimator that accurately predicts relative eigenvalue errors in finite element models reduced by Guyan reduction. We present a derivation procedure for the error estimator, in which Kidder's transformation matrix for Guyan reduction is employed. We demonstrate the excellent performance of the proposed error estimator through various numerical examples: rectangular plate, cylindrical panel, hyperboloid panel, and shaft-shaft interaction problems.
